COPD and Gabapentin use.

Posted by nan1953 @nan1953, Jun 9, 2022

I have COPD on O2 3 liters. I also have Diabetic Neuropathy . I was prescribed Gabapentin . I'm afraid to take the Gabapentin because of the warnings that it is not recommended for people with COPD. I would like to know if anyone here is taking Gapapentin. Thanks.

I have COPD and take 1800 mg Gabapentin. The only side effect I have is dry mouth. Both my Pulmonologist and pain doctor know of my meds and never mentioned a problem. Gab has really helped the back pain but pretty sure this one will wind up with surgery.

I was taking 1500 mg of neurontin at night prior to getting COPD. Neither of my doctors were concerned. I have COPD, emphysema, asthma and bronchiectasis. I think I’m stage 2. I am on 2L of oxygen at night.
I have since taken myself down to 600 mg of neurontin. The internist wants me to stay at this dose for my legs/back. He informed me that neurontin was a very safe drug
